5 PRESSURE BOOSTING FUNCTION

The E.box panel can be used for making a system to increase water pressure. As control inputs, either pressure
switches on a pressure sensor can be used. To operate, the panel requires an expansion vessel.

5.1 Expansion vessel

In pressure boosting it is necessary to use an expansion vessel of at least 19 litres per pump.

5.2 Electrical connections of pump and supply

Connect the supply line and the pumps as described in the chapter ELECTRICAL CONNECTIONS.
5.3 Connection of additional protections: high pressure, low pressure and motor thermal
protection
It is possible, but not necessary, to use the alarm inputs to the E.box so that the pumps stop in the case of pressure
that is too high, too low, or too high motor temperature. In the case of an alarm, the pumps stop, the alarm leds blink,
the corresponding alarm outputs are activated. If the display is present, the type of alarm is indicated. When the alarm
conditions no longer exist, the E.box resumes normal operation.
Alarm, Pressure in system too high: the pressure switch must be installed in the delivery of the set. The
normally closed contact of the pressure switch must be connected to terminal R of the E.box. The pressure
switch must be set at the maximum pressure that can be reached by the system. If it is not used, the contact
is jumpered.
Alarm, Pressure in system too low: the pressure switch can be installed either on suction or on delivery
depending on the type of system. The pressure switch must be connected to terminal N of the E.box, it must
be set at the minimum pressure necessary for the system to work correctly. The contact must open if the
pressure falls below the minimum value. This contact may be used either to prevent blocks for lack of water or
to discover burst pipes. A level probe or float can also be connected to this alarm to check the state of a tank
or well. If it is not used, the contact is jumpered.
Motor thermal protection: the device has an input for the thermal protection of each motor. If the motor used
is provided with thermal protection, this protection can be connected to the terminals KK shown in Figure 9. If
there is no protection in the motor, the terminals must be jumpered.
If the alarms are not used, the corresponding inputs must be jumpered. So jumpers must be fitted on the inputs of the
contacts N, R, KK1 and KK2. These jumpers are provided with the E-box.
